This rite of passage ceremony - is a women's immersion into her Wild Body, Soul and Earth. As a part of the ceremony there is a multi-day fast where each woman sits alone in the wilderness with no food and minimal shelter (2-4 days solo depending on the Immersion). This intimate ceremony marks a time of profound transition in ones life and is an ancient and powerful way to release heavy energies, connect to the earth and our bodies, embody belonging, return to wholeness, tend to our humanness, embrace our gifts and begin to manifest our deepest truths.

While this wilderness fast ceremony holds and is inspired by aspects of various indigenous traditions and cultures, it is not the same as what you may know of as a Vision Quest or Hanbleceya. If you are seeking this kind of ceremony, it is recommended that you search elsewhere to honor these traditional ways. The Soul Wilderness Fast is created as a bridge between these ancient ceremonial rites and the modern world, to weave a path that is palpable for a wide range of women, their body's, backgrounds and lifestyles.
Soul Wilderness Fast: A Women's Rite of Passage
This intimate group of women will gather in the magical lands of Abiquiu, New Mexico near the Chama River for a 6 day Wilderness Immersion and Fasting Ceremony. Fasters will go alone into the wilderness without food and minimal shelter. The first two days will be spent in preparatory rituals and teachings, followed by two days and two nights fasting in their solo sites. The final day will be spent mirroring the stories of each faster and beginning the incorporation processes as we prepare to return home.
